Репозиторий почти всегда требует реквизитов доступа. И, если вы их не храните в локальной конфигурации, то скрипты, содержащие git pull, будут прерываться, запрашивая пару логин/пароль.
Передать реквизиты с отдельным ключом нельзя, но можно задать репозиторий, где попутно указать и реквизиты:
|
git pull https://username:password@bitbucket.org/project.git |
Пароль может содержать разнообразные символы, в том числе и те, что нарушают формат команды, их разрешается закодировать используя ASCII коды с префиксом ‘%’. К примеру, команда с паролем ‘pass()word’ будет выглядеть так:
|
git pull https://username:pass%28%29word@bitbucket.org/project.git |
git
Написать комментарий
Данная запись опубликована в 11.12.2021 21:44 и размещена в рубрике Программирование.
Вы можете перейти в конец страницы и оставить ваш комментарий.
Мало букафф? Читайте есчо !
Август 19, 2021 г.
GitGub отключили парольную авторизацию, и предлагают использовать SSH с PAT. О том как это настроить и использовать читайте далее в статье.
Сложно избавиться о раздражения, когда требуется что то опять настраивать для выполнения ежедневных рутинных ...
Читать
Июль 17, 2017 г.
Настройки в файле .gitignore позволяют исключить из списка файлов сканируемых GIT, все то что отслеживать не надо. Обычно это так называемые юзер-файлы, изображения, архивы, документация и т.п.
В данной статье рассмотрим типовой случай настоек в .gitignore. ...
Читать